Users who use screw air compressors often complain about the accumulation of water in the head of the air compressor, and some even appear on the new screw air compressor that has just been used for a short time, causing the head of the screw machine of the air compressor to rust or even get stuck and damaged, losing money and time.
First of all, we need to find out why the screw air compressor accumulates water:
definition of dew point: Under a fixed pressure, the temperature at which the gaseous water contained in the air reaches saturation and condenses into liquid water.
Our atmosphere contains water vapor, which is what we usually call humidity. This water will enter the screw air compressor with the atmosphere.
When the screw air compressor is running, the dew point of the compressed air will decrease with the increase of the pressure, but at the same time, the compression process will also generate a lot of compression heat. The oil temperature of the compressor in normal operation is designed to be above 80°C, so that the heat of compression volatilizes the water in the air into a gaseous state and discharges it to the back end with the compressed air.
If the selection of air compressor is too large, or the user's gas consumption is extremely small, the running load rate of screw machine is seriously low, which will lead to the oil temperature not reaching above 80 ℃ for a long time, even lower than the dew point. At this time, the moisture in the compressed air will condense into a liquid state and remain inside the air compressor, mixed with the lubricating oil. At this time, the oil filter and the oil core will increase the load and fail quickly. In severe cases, the oil will deteriorate and emulsify, causing the main engine rotor to rust and jam.
When the ambient temperature is 20 ℃ and the relative humidity is 100, under the pressure of 10KG, the exhaust temperature below 68 ℃ will produce condensed water. With reference to this figure, you can inquire about the temperature of condensed water under different conditions.
In the following situations, pay special attention to whether the air compressor is flooded:
factory trial production stage, capacity is not fully opened
high humidity and humid environment, such as Huangmei rainy season in Jiangnan area
unit loading rate continuously below 30%
solution
in the selection of equipment, be sure to ask professionals to choose the appropriate power of the air compressor unit.
In the case of low gas consumption or high humidity, the screw machine is shut down for 6 hours and then drain the condensate in the oil and gas barrel until the oil flows out. (Regular discharge is required, and how long it takes depends on the use environment of the screw machine)
for the air-cooled unit, the fan temperature switch can be properly adjusted and the heat dissipation can be adjusted to increase the oil temperature; for the water-cooled unit, the water intake of the cooling water can be properly adjusted to ensure the oil temperature of the air compressor. For the frequency conversion unit, the minimum operating frequency can be appropriately increased to increase the machine speed and increase the operating load.
For users with particularly small gas consumption, properly discharge the pressure of the regular back-end gas tank to artificially increase the operating load of the machine.
The use of genuine lubricating oil, a better oil-water separation, not easy to emulsify. Check the oil level before each boot to see if there is any abnormal rise or oil emulsification.
